1. **What are the best math apps for beginners?**
If you're just starting out, apps like Khan Academy Kids, Photomath, and DragonBox are fantastic. They focus on building a strong foundation with simple, interactive lessons. For example, Photomath lets you scan math problems with your phone’s camera and provides instant solutions with detailed explanations. It’s like having a math tutor in your pocket!

2. **Can math apps really help with advanced topics?**
Absolutely! Apps like Brilliant and Wolfram Alpha are perfect for tackling complex subjects like algebra, geometry, and even calculus. Brilliant offers in-depth courses and puzzles that challenge your problem-solving skills, while Wolfram Alpha is a powerhouse for solving equations and visualizing graphs. These tools are great for high school and college students.

4. **Are there free math apps worth trying?**
Yes, plenty! Apps like Khan Academy, Mathway, and Prodigy offer free versions with tons of features. Khan Academy, for instance, provides free courses on everything from basic math to advanced topics. It’s a great resource if you’re on a budget but still want high-quality learning materials.

5. **How can parents use math apps to help their kids?**
Parents can use apps like ABCmouse or SplashLearn to introduce math concepts to younger kids in a fun way. These apps are designed with colorful graphics and engaging activities to keep kids interested. Plus, many apps allow parents to monitor their child’s progress and adjust the difficulty level as needed.
